Replacement clauses for Stand-alone EMI Option Agreement to be used in an EMI option rollover

This document provides three background clauses, one definition, one operative clause, one testimonium and two signature clauses to be substituted into a Stand-alone EMI option agreement.

This will produce a suitable precedent agreement for the release of an existing EMI option (over shares in a company now under the control of another) in consideration of the grant of a replacement EMI option (by the acquiring company) under the statutory EMI option rollover provisions.
